Understanding Exercise Bikes
Exercise bikes are flexible devices created to simulate the experience of outside biking. They are available in various types, consisting of upright bikes, recumbent bikes, and fixed bikes, each accommodating different physical fitness requirements and preferences.
Types of Exercise Bikes
| Type | Description | Perfect For |
|---|---|---|
| Upright Bikes | More conventional bike posture; resembles outside bikes | Individuals wanting a full-body exercise |
| Recumbent Bikes | Kick back with a supported back-rest; pedals in front | Those with neck and back pain or movement concerns |
| Spin Bikes | Usually much heavier and developed for high-intensity workouts | Spin class lovers and advanced users |
| Folding Bikes | Compact and portable; can be folded for storage | Users with minimal area |
Secret Features to Consider
When browsing an exercise bike store, understanding the key features can help pinpoint the ideal model. Here's a list of vital features to consider:
- Resistance Levels: Look for bikes that offer adjustable resistance to customize workouts according to physical fitness levels.
- Seat Comfort: A comfy seat is crucial for longer trips; look for adjustability and cushioning.
- Display Console: Many bikes featured digital consoles showing important metrics like time, distance, speed, and calories burned.
- Bluetooth Connectivity: Some modern-day bikes allow syncing with apps or gadgets for tracking development and accessing workouts.
- Weight Capacity: Ensure the bike can support your weight for both safety and sturdiness.
- Warranty and Service: Check the guarantee information and after-sales service for comfort.
Selecting the Ideal Bike for Your Workout Goals
Every individual's physical fitness journey is different, so specific requirements need to guide the choice of an exercise bike. Below is a table that aligns different fitness objectives with ideal bike types.
| Fitness Goal | Recommended Bike Type | Thinking |
|---|---|---|
| Weight reduction | Upright/Spin Bike | Greater strength, calorie burn |
| Rehabilitation | Recumbent Bike | Supportive and easy on joints |
| Building Endurance | Spin Bike | Permits increased resistance and intensity |
| General Fitness | Upright Bike | Versatile and suitable for all levels |
| Compact Space Usage | Folding Bike | Space-saving without compromising exercise quality |

Frequently asked questions
1. How much should I anticipate to spend on an exercise bike?
Exercise bikes can vary from ₤ 200 for standard designs to over ₤ 2,000 for high-end designs with innovative functions and tech. You should consider how typically you plan to use the bike and your budget plan when making a choice.
2. Are stationary bicycle good for all fitness levels?
Yes! Exercise bikes deal with different fitness levels, making them suitable for everybody, from newbies to fitness lovers.
3. How typically should I utilize an exercise bike to see outcomes?
Consistency is key. Go for a minimum of 150 minutes of moderate-intensity cardio weekly, which can be broken down into day-to-day sessions for finest results.
4. Do I require unique shoes for biking on an exercise bike?
While specialized cycling shoes improve performance on particular bikes (especially spin bikes), numerous models accommodate routine athletic shoes.
5. Can I see television or read while utilizing an exercise bike?
Definitely! One of the substantial benefits of stationary biking is the capability to multitask. Numerous users delight in capturing up on their preferred programs or reading while working out.
Tips for Maximizing Your Exercise Bike Experience
- Warm-Up and Cool Down: Start every session with a warm-up to avoid injury, and finish with a cool-down to help recovery.
- Preserve Proper Form: Keep a straight back and engage your core while pedaling to prevent stress.
- Integrate Intervals: Mix high-intensity sprints with steady-paced biking to boost calorie burn and keep exercises intriguing.
- Set Goals: Having clear, achievable goals can inspire and improve responsibility.
- Stay Hydrated: Keep water close by to maintain hydration during exercises.
